    A “friend of mine” recently checked his Flying Club account and much to his surprise is now a Silver Member. Other than credit card activity, he has only taken 2 VS flights, both economy and both on redemption.

    Without kicking up a fuss, can anyone explain why he is Silver and where he might find out? Or is this just a bug? Any ideas welcome!

    744 posts

    The official qualifying criteria to reach Silver relies on the notion of an upgrade cycle, which is calculated as 366 days from the date of joining (one day after the date of joining for a further one year). The first year of Red to Silver requires 400 TPs. Renewing Silver or Silver to Gold relies on a fixed year, from the first date you received Silver for one year (in which you need 400 or 1000 TPs for Silver or Gold, respectively).

    Has “your friend” got 400 TPs in the past two years? Redemptions count, as VS lets customers earn TPs on redemptions. Check your friend’s statement. That said, VS is not exactly not au fait with dodgy IT, and it usually works in your friend’s favour…
